3647-Could Iran unravel an Obama reelection, Republicans hope so

Gas, not even a four letter word and yet so powerful, enough to possibly decide a U.S. Presidential election. It seems perfect and almost by design that an oil war with Iran could detrack an incumbent president and set the stage for what we thought in worse case would be Mitt Romney, but in a nightmarish scenario could be Rick Santorum, with Newt Gingrich as vice-president. Some polls of Americans at this moment - and definitely unscientific, show a disturbing shift in the Right camp towards evangelical Rick Santorum. Romney, the front-runner may not have given in to the religious right enough to sustain his previous lead. Now Barack Obama is faced with a real problem: Iran.
It's not the all out war some dreaded and most thought was not yet due - it's that other war, the gas price war, the one that comes straight to the driveway of most Americans. Iran has fired a few of it's European countries as customers due to sanctions designed to ferret out the fiesty Iran on its nuclear development. The truth is Iran does not need Europe so much any more, with Asia standing with mouth wide open,guzzling all the oil it can be given.
Gas prices are going up for Americans this summer and there is no way around it, it's going to reflect bad on Barack Obama. Iran may have delivered a gift to American Republicans it did not consider or intend. However, if Iran thinks the current American government has a tough stance on Iran, then let Iran imagine the possibilities of a future American president. If that's no problem for Iran then I am sure it's no problem for the future leaders of America. -Preston Brady III, MobileTribune.com
